Sure thing! So, "caster" has a few different meanings, but let's start with the most common one. A caster is basically a type of wheel that's attached to something, like a piece of furniture or a cart. It's designed to make it easier to move that thing around, because the wheel can spin in any direction. It's like having a little mini vehicle under whatever you attach it to!

Now, there's another meaning of "caster" that you might hear about in the context of cooking. In that case, a caster is a kind of kitchen tool that's used to sprinkle things like sugar or flour onto your food. It's kind of like a little magic wand for food, helping you add just the right amount of those ingredients to your recipes.
